C&R Restaurant Group
25 mile radius of San Dimas, CA
yesterday
Placentia, CA, US
Glendora, CA, US
San Dimas, CA, US
Whittier, CA, US
Anaheim, CA, US
Whittier, CA, US
Alhambra, CA, US
Alhambra, CA, US
La Mirada, CA, US
Placentia, CA, US